The Anatomy of The Bear: Lessons From Wall Street’s Four Great Bottoms by Russell Napier shares details in the bear markets in many periods of Wall Street. Specifically, the four great bottoms include 1921, 1932, 1949 and 1982.
The author provides detailed explanations of topics related to the bear market in Wall Street. Instead of theorizing how they should work, Russell shows the proven techniques and strategies that work based on databases and objective chart reading.
